Deodorant Sniff Laboratory Test

A deodorant sniff test is a controlled sensory evaluation used to determine how effectively a deodorant reduces or masks body odour over time. In this test, volunteers apply the product under standardized conditions, after which trained assessors evaluate the odour intensity of the underarm area at predefined timepoints (such as baseline, 12 hours, 24 hours, and 48 hours). The odour is scored using a structured scale, allowing for objective comparison between treated and untreated areas or against a control product. This method provides measurable data on odour reduction and is widely used to support claims such as “long-lasting freshness” or “24-hour odour protection.”

Test Procedure

  1. Volunteer selection:
    Ten participants representative of the target population are selected.
  2. Baseline assessment (T0):
    Initial odor evaluation is performed prior to product application.
  3. Product application:
    The deodorant is applied according to its intended use.
  4. Wear period:
    Participants carry out normal daily activities.
  5. Follow-up assessments:
    Odor intensity is evaluated at selected time points (e.g., 12h, 24h, 48h).
  6. Data comparison:
    Results are compared to baseline to determine odor reduction performance.

Parameters Evaluated

  • Odor intensity — sensory evaluation
  • Odor control over time
  • Percentage reduction compared to baseline
  • Duration of deodorant effectiveness
  • Overall product performance score
